当前位置: 首页 > 计算模拟 >matlab如何将一个循环计算的结果保存在一个矩阵里?

matlab如何将一个循环计算的结果保存在一个矩阵里?

作者 一禾平c
来源: 小木虫 350 7 举报帖子
+关注

请高手指教!抱拳

通过计算后得到xx,yy希望把之前步骤中循环计算出来的结果保存成一个矩阵应该怎么编写代码?

xx yy是根据圆心和半径以及角度来确定圆上的某个点,这里的xx yy 不确定有多少个数,

    xx=Cir(i,3)*cos(theta)+Cir(i,1);
    yy=Cir(i,3)*sin(theta)+Cir(i,2);

如何将xx yy 保存成矩阵呢?请高手指教!感谢!! 返回小木虫查看更多

今日热帖
  • 精华评论
  • 一禾平c

    请高手指教!!非常感谢!!

  • 曾经落伍了

    定义空矩阵,计算出结果加入空矩阵

  • hzlhm

    可以通过for循环语句来实现。
    k=0;
    for i=1:n
    k=k+1
        xx(k)=Cir(i,3)*cos(theta)+Cir(i,1);
        yy(k)=Cir(i,3)*sin(theta)+Cir(i,2);
    end

  • 一禾平c

    引用回帖:
    4楼: Originally posted by hzlhm at 2020-11-14 13:29:53
    可以通过for循环语句来实现。
    k=0;
    for i=1:n
    k=k+1
        xx(k)=Cir(i,3)*cos(theta)+Cir(i,1);
        yy(k)=Cir(i,3)*sin(theta)+Cir(i,2);
    end

    您好,通过for循环语句计算xx yy后,如何将xx yy的所有数值保存到一个矩阵里呢?后续想要利用这些xx yy

  • 一禾平c

    引用回帖:
    3楼: Originally posted by 曾经落伍了 at 2020-11-14 12:30:03
    定义空矩阵,计算出结果加入空矩阵

    您好,我是在一个循环语句中计算出许多xx yy,方便详细一点吗?

  • hzlhm

    引用回帖:
    5楼: Originally posted by 一禾平c at 2020-11-14 15:05:21
    您好,通过for循环语句计算xx yy后,如何将xx yy的所有数值保存到一个矩阵里呢?后续想要利用这些xx yy...

    如后续想要利用这些xx yy,可以保存在mat或xls文件里,以便后期调用。

猜你喜欢
下载小木虫APP
与700万科研达人随时交流
  • 二维码
  • IOS
  • 安卓